Voci del Pokédex

Generation I
Red:
Because it stores several kinds of toxic gases in its body, it is prone to exploding without warning.
Yellow:
In hot places, its internal gases could expand and explode without any warning. Be very careful!
Generation II
Gold:
Its thin, filmy body is filled with gases that cause constant sniffles, coughs and teary eyes.
Silver:
The poisonous gases it contains are a little bit lighter than air, keeping it slight­ ly airborne.
Crystal:
If one gets close enough to it when it expels poison­ ous gas, the gas swirling inside it can be seen.
Generation III
Ruby:
If KOFFING becomes agitated, it raises the toxicity of its internal gases and jets them out from all over its body. This Pokémon may also overinflate its round body, then explode.
Sapphire:
KOFFING embodies toxic substances. It mixes the toxins with raw garbage to set off a chemical reaction that results in a terribly powerful poison gas. The higher the temperature, the more gas is concocted by this Pokémon.
Emerald:
Getting up close to a KOFFING will give you a chance to observe, through its thin skin, the toxic gases swirling inside. It blows up at the slightest stimulation.
